Stantec is one of the few Engineering Consultancies in New Zealand with in-house expertise in all disciplines required for water resource management. We can provide a comprehensive array of services encompassing innovative conceptual planning, investigations and feasibility studies, environmental planning, financial, economic and energy modelling, risk assessment, design, procurement, asset management, refurbishment, and enhancement. In addition to providing traditional engineering, design, and construction management services, we have experience with complex design-builds, alliancing, programme management, information technology, asset management and business consulting.
The Opportunity Due to projects wins in our water group, a great opportunity for an experienced Project Manager with 5 year's project management experience based in our Wellington office has arisen.
In this role you will work closely with our senior team of experienced engineers and project managers to continue our excellent project delivery track record. You will have proven experience successfully delivering projects, working within highly performing teams, and contributing to the financial success of a business. Excellent organisation and time management skills are a given, along with a high level of financial competency, and an ability to prioritise tasks and multi-task to ensure deadlines are achieved. You will also have the ability to assist with bids & proposals to ensure we can effectively deliver what we promise. Fostering team performance and being an effective and efficient communicator will be essential to your success in this role. You will have ideally achieved Project Management qualifications or working towards the attainment of a recognised qualification.
